**Ticket: Config drift after N+1 fix in Ledgerspool GraphQL layer**

The resolver batching added to fix the N+1 on the invoices query shipped with hand-edited loader settings on two production nodes. These never made it back into the repo, so fresh deploys regress to unbatched behavior. Future maintainers: treat the repo as the source of truth once this ticket closes. The intended batching configuration, to be committed, is as follows.

config for tagep-yajef:
ulawyn:
  log_level: error
  metrics_host: metrics.ulawyn.lumiclabs.internal
  pin: 0564
  pool_size: 32

Handover note — Velthorn Labs, Dunmere site

Marta, the locked case with the twelve Orvix test handsets is now in the equipment room, shelf C. The inventory sheet is taped inside the lid; all units were charged and wiped this morning. The case stays locked until the courier from Bramwick Transit arrives Thursday between 09:00 and 10:00. Do not open it for internal requests — these units are earmarked for the Fenlow trial. The courier hand-over instruction follows below.

courier memo of yahif-faweg: the quenael tamius courier leaves the prawyn jorix kaswyn istox silmir brieth zormir fenvan ledger at gate 3145 under passcode 231062

// Assignment salt version for the Bramblewick experiment service.
// Security note: this constant only versions the hashing salt used
// to bucket users; it carries no secret material itself. Rotating it
// reshuffles all experiment assignments, so bumps must be coordinated
// with the analysis team and logged in the rotation ledger. The value
// below was last rotated in the build recorded on the next line.

session token of fawep-tajep = htk14_4221f8eaf43a2f

## FeedCheck environment variables

Hey future maintainers — FeedCheck is the podcast feed validator we run for the Murmurcast network, and its config is mostly boring. POLL_INTERVAL, MAX_FEED_SIZE, and STRICT_RSS all have sane defaults in settings.py, so you rarely touch them. The only thing you actually have to set by hand is the credential for the fetch proxy, which goes in the local env file. Put it on the line immediately after this one.

secret setting of baduf-fahag: LEDGER_TOKEN8=35e35511